About Venue
Beautiful classic Parisan style two floor bistro and bar situated very close to Liverpool's historic docklands and commercial district.
Ma Boyle's neighbours include St Nicholas church and has hosted events such as launch parties, office parties, birthdays, weddings, funerals and leaving parties. Our Rum & Rumour Kaberet Bar holds 50-60 people and our ground floor bar can hold a further 120. Our outside drinking space backs onto the beatuful church gardens and Liverpool's cruise liner terminal. Very good transport links, close to local rail and bus links. 5 min walk from Liverpool One.
